For the 2026 school year, there are 3 private elementary schools serving 677 students in the neighborhood of Back Bay, Boston, MA.
The top-ranked private elementary schools in Back Bay include The Learning Project Elementary School, Kingsley Montessori School, and The Newman School.
The average acceptance rate is 36%, which is lower than the Massachusetts private elementary school average acceptance rate of 73%.
